What's The Definition Of Buntline?Synonyms | Synonyms for Buntline: Related Terms | Find terms related to Buntline: See Also | Buntline In Webster's Dictionary \Bunt"line\, n. [2d bunt + line.] (Naut.)
One of the ropes toggled to the footrope of a sail, used to
haul up to the yard the body of the sail when taking it in.
--Totten.
